‘Guardians of the Galaxy Vol. 2’ debuted its latest concept art showing Star-Lord’s newly assembled yet unexpected alliances. In addition to Gamora, Drax, Rocket, and Groot, the new team included Yondu, Nebula, and Mantis.
According to the Independent, director James Gunn revealed the upcoming film’s latest concept art revealing brand new members of Peter Quill’s band of intergalactic misfits-turned-heroes. Gunn’s Facebook post showed three unexpected characters specifically Michael Rooker’s Yondu, Pom Klementieff’s Mantis, and Karen Gillan’s Nebula.
It remains unclear whether these three new characters will team up with Peter Quill a.k.a. Star-Lord’s group until the end but it certainly seems that they will form alliances at some point. In Gunn’s first film, Yondu hunted down Peter for betraying the Ravagers but ended up helping him in the war against Ronan the Accuser. Nebula was definitely a villain as she worked as an assassin for her adoptive father, the intergalactic war lord Thanos.
Mantis, meanwhile, is a brand new character introduced into the cinematic series. According to Entertainment Weekly, she is depicted as an alien woman with antennae growing out of her head. Executive producer Jonathan Schwartz teased, “She has never really experienced social interaction… Everything she learns about dealing with people, she learns from the Guardians of the Galaxy, which is a very weird group to learn your social intricacies from.”
Rooker, Klementieff, and Gillan join Chris Pratt’s Peter in the poster together with the rest of the original crew made up of Zoe Saldana’s Gamora, Bradley Cooper’s Rocket Racoon, Dave Bautista’s Drax, and a tiny version of Vin Diesel’s Groot.
Schwartz revealed that baby Groot will not be the same as Diesel’s original tree man in the first film. He said, “He doesn’t have the wisdom and experience of that Groot… He’s a younger Groot and a more rambunctious Groot. The question is, is he the same Groot, just smaller? Or is he a different Groot that’s sprung up from the seed of the first Groot?”
‘Guardians of the Galaxy Vol. 2’ is an upcoming superhero film scheduled to be released on May 5, 2017. It is intended as the third film in Marvel Cinematic Universe’s (MCU) Phase Three.
It also the follow-up to Gunn’s critically and commercially successful film released in 2014. The first film grossed $773.31 million worldwide against a production budget of $170 million and became the year’s highest-grossing superhero film.
